Job Description

Summary
The intern for Layton Construction aids and assists the Project Engineers, Project Managers and Superintendents on construction projects (or other departments such as scheduling, estimating, or others if internship is designated to do so). 

Duties

  • Champions “The Layton Way” by delivering predictable outcomes for internal teams, external teams, and customers.
  • Ensures that “Constructing with Integrity” is delivered by working with honesty, unity, safety, and quality of work.
  • Becomes familiar with the assigned project plans and specifications in order to assist the engineer with the project.
  •  Process RFI’s, Submittals (collects from subcontractors and distributes to architects/engineers/consultants).
  • Assists in creating pay applications
  • Distributes drawings and communicates information to subcontractors
  • Collects and organizes bid information
  • Prepares Project Review packages
  • Assists in publishing weekly progress reports for assigned projects 
  • Completes follow up for receipt, review, and distribution of information required for project construction.
  • Researches construction problems.
  • Updates project schedules as needed.
  • Assists in bidding and in developing scope of work for trade contractors.
  • Follows up for review and approval for shop drawings, samples, material lists, etc.
  • Maintains logs, reflecting the status of shop drawings, requests for clarification, change requests, and proposal requests.
  • Assist in ensuring appropriate materials are available for the preparation of the project

Qualifications                            

  • Required: Sophomore, Junior, or Senior in University.
  • Prior internship preferred but not necessary.
  • Construction industry experience preferred.

Layton Construction is a privately held national general contractor, delivering predictable outcomes in commercial construction since 1953. Headquartered in Salt Lake City, Utah, Layton operates from 16 strategic offices across the United States, employing more than 1,500 construction professionals who serve diverse markets including healthcare, education, commercial office, industrial, hospitality, and multi-unit residential.
Founded on the core values of honesty, unity, safety, and quality, Layton has built a reputation for excellence in complex project delivery while maintaining strong partnerships with clients, architects, and trade partners nationwide.

Structure Tone was founded in 1971 in NYC, as an interior construction focused builder. With offices in New York, Boston, New Jersey, and Philadelphia, our growth over the past five decades has been centered on client relationships and following our original client-first philosophy that no job is too small or large, and client satisfaction is always our top project goal.
